Content page high rank than homepage

On one of my KWs which ranked 1st page about 5th, has slipped to about position 33.

However, a content page is showing about 10th for singular and 12th for plural version.

I know i have some good links to the internal page but this seems to have happened over night and the homepage dropped significantly.

All my SEO done is purely white hat.

It just seems strange that the homepage has dropped so much as this has some great links and many many more to it aswell.

Any explanations appreciated.

There could be many reasons for this. You might have lost good quality links to your home page or if it is a fairly new site then google may just have shifted your possition in the serps as they sometimes give new sites increased possition initialy and the reduce.

I wouldnt be to concerned that your content page is ranking higher, in fact I would see this as being a great sign for the quality of your content. people are linking to it for a reason. This will also add value to your link profile as just having links going to your home page isnt ideal.

It also means that you are getting traffic deeper into your site which can help with conversion as long as the landing page is effective

I think that you would need to test it. I tend to believe that sales are king. I would happily get a little less traffic as a result of changing a page but that leads to an increased number of sales.

This might not be the case when you are looking for maximum exposue to attract links but for me the reason I do this is to earn a few bucks!

You might find that you dont have to change a great deal if you decide you would rather have a higher placing for your home page over a content page. You need to look at the details and try to work out the reason. I know it can be difficult but there must be a reason for the ranking.
